Mother tiger shark

Mother tiger shark

In 1982, during the dissection of a mother tiger shark, a scientist named Stewart Springer reaching into the birth canal was bitten by a tiger shark embryo, which are notoriously cannibalistic. This is the only recorded instance where someone was bitten by an unborn animal.
